Advanced Data Analysis with AI

Artificial intelligence is revolutionizing how marketers analyze data. AI can process vast amounts of information quickly, providing insights into customer behavior and trends. This allows for hyper-personalization, where marketing messages are tailored to individual customer journeys. By using AI, marketers can see patterns in real-time that might be missed with traditional methods. This capability is crucial for effective demand forecasting and strategic decisions. With AI, marketers can better understand customer patterns, predict behaviors like churn, and plan personalized strategies to retain customers.

Predictive Analytics

Predictive analytics uses AI and historical data to foresee future trends. This approach helps marketing teams analyze millions of data points swiftly, extracting valuable insights efficiently. With machine learning, these analytics can uncover patterns hidden in consumer data, aiding in developing effective marketing strategies. Marketers can predict the best times to send offers, craft resonant messages, and choose the right marketing channels. Predictive analytics helps businesses build long-term models, evaluate risks, and improve product designs based on past customer behaviors.

Real-time Insights

AI offers marketers the power to make informed decisions instantly. Real-time insights enable fast adjustments to marketing strategies, avoiding the delays of waiting for campaign reviews. By using AI-driven analytics, marketers can optimize media choices on the fly and respond quickly to customer context. This reduces the time needed for traditional data analysis, making marketing campaigns more efficient. Real-time insights shift marketers from reactive to proactive strategies, helping achieve business goals. Through AI, companies can enhance return on investment by implementing cost-saving measures and improving marketing effectiveness.

Feedback and Sentiment Analysis

Sentiment analysis algorithms measure customer sentiments from feedback, such as social media, surveys, and reviews. These algorithms assign polarity scores from -1 to +1, allowing businesses to interpret customer perceptions better.

By evaluating sentiment, companies can gain valuable insight into their reputation management strategies. Integrating sentiment analysis into marketing strategies allows a deep understanding of customer emotions. This understanding helps adapt marketing and sales approaches to better meet customer expectations.

Moreover, AI’s advancements in sentiment analysis predict customer emotions expressed online. This foresight helps companies tailor their marketing strategies more effectively. In the fast-paced marketing industry, real-time insights provide an edge in creating positive customer experiences.

Data Privacy

Data privacy is a critical concern in AI marketing. To protect customer information, companies should program privacy rules directly into AI solutions. This helps with compliance and ensures protection. AI tools must anonymize personal data and use encryption and access controls to safeguard information. Privacy concerns include how long data is kept and who might access it. Companies must address these concerns to maintain consumer trust. Ethical data collection and use are key for enhancing customer journeys and ensuring AI tools are free from bias. By adhering to data privacy regulations such as GDPR, businesses can safeguard consumer trust and privacy.

Bias and Fairness

Bias and fairness are essential for ethical AI marketing. AI models can have algorithmic bias due to the data or the algorithms themselves. This can lead to unfair outcomes. Companies must regularly assess their models to identify and fix biases. Transparency and explainability are major concerns, especially as AI becomes more complex. Models need to clearly explain their decision-making processes. Successful marketing doesn’t rely solely on algorithms. Human intelligence, creativity, and empathy are also important. Together, these elements ensure fairness and improve conversion rates within digital marketing campaigns.
